Emergency Damage Restoration Cost in the 2091 Area
The cost of emergency damage restoration can vary widely depending on the severity and size of the affected area, as well as local conditions in the 2091 area. These estimates are based on average costs and may not reflect the actual cost of your specific restoration project.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Emergency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local water table |
| Structural Drying Process |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and type of materials affected |
| Mold Inspection and Testing |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and type of mold present |
| Containment and Air Filtration |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and type of mold present |
| Sewage Cleanup |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and type of sewage present |
| Basement Flood Recovery |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and type of materials affected |

Common Questions About Emergency Damage Restoration in the 2091 Area
How long does emergency damage restoration take?
We’ll work to complete your restoration project as quickly and efficiently as possible, often within 3-5 days. But, the actual timeframe will depend on the severity and size of the affected area, as well as local conditions.
Is emergency damage restoration covered by insurance?
Yes, emergency damage restoration is often covered by insurance. Our team will work directly with your provider to ensure a smooth claims process and increase your coverage.
What causes mold growth in the 2091 area?
Mold growth is often caused by excess moisture, poor ventilation, and high humidity levels. Our team will work to identify and address the underlying causes of mold growth and develop a plan for remediation.
